Assistant Professor – Instructional Technology

The College of Education and Social Sciences at Coastal Carolina University invites applications for a tenure-track, full time (9-month) position as Assistant Professor of Instructional Technology, with a desired beginning date of January 1, 2023. Responsibilities include teaching instructional technology and computer science education graduate and undergraduate courses in traditional, hybrid, and online learning formats, advising students, maintaining an active research agenda, and engaging in relevant service to the college, university, and local schools.

Requirements include an earned doctorate or ABD in instructional/educational technology, instructional design, or similar field emphasizing the integration of technology to improve teaching, learning, and professional practice in education. Experience designing, developing, and implementing instructional technology courses for pre-service and in-service educators.

The ideal candidate will be an outstanding teacher-scholar with experience teaching instructional technology and computer science education courses to both pre-service and in-service educators. A key responsibility of this position will be to lead the unit in teaching and managing new degree and certificate programs in computer science education that meet emerging job trends and establish continuity with our successful graduate programs. Teaching expectations will include computer science education and instructional technology courses. The ideal candidate will also have prior experience obtaining external funding for instructional technology/computer science education research initiatives, and experience collaborating on instructional technology/computer science education initiatives with corporate/private partners. The ideal candidate will also be expected to collaborate with colleagues to advance scholarly projects serving local and national needs. ABD encouraged to apply.

A review of applications will begin on October 19th and continue until the position is filled.Coastal Carolina University is a public comprehensive liberal arts institution located in Conway, South Carolina, minutes from the Atlantic coastal resort city of Myrtle Beach. Coastal Carolina University enrolls over 10,000 students from 46 states and 53 nations. The University is accredited by the Southern Association of Colleges and Schools to award the baccalaureate and selective master’s degrees of national and/or regional significance in the arts and sciences, business, humanities, education, and health and human services, a specialist degree in educational leadership, and Ph.D. degrees in Marine Science and Education.Coastal Carolina University is committed to fostering an environment that embraces diversity, equity and inclusion, and we seek candidates who will contribute to a climate that supports the growth and development of a diverse campus community.
